
Blackstone Consulting, Inc. (BCI) is a minority-owned, 9,000 employee, global service provider overseeing account services in food, environmental, facility maintenance, professional staffing, and security. BCI seeks a dedicated and passionate Healthcare Security Supervisors to serve as an integral part of the security and care delivery team for a leading healthcare providerThe Security Supervisor will supervise shifts; act as relief to the Security Account Manager during off-hours, or for limited absences; conduct roving patrol and incident supervision in complex facilities.
The Security Supervisor will assist with multiple contracts within the BCI enterprise; the support will be designed to assist in delegated service areas through the network.

Founded in 1991 by company President Joe Blackstone, Blackstone Consulting, Inc. (BCI) is a national and international service provider performing services in Environmental, Security, Facilities Maintenance, Staffing and Food Service Management.
BCI is a minority-owned company with credentials in a number of national, regional and local programs, including the NMSDC Corporate Plus Program, which attest to our commitment to excellence.
We work with the leading HMO in the country, a leader in the aerospace industry, leading utility companies and many others in our core service areas.
